Air, oil tight rigid steel tank prevents oil leakage, infiltration of moisture and water into tank.
Bending or folding is priority in tank construction rather than welding to lessen any possibility
of deterioration of insulation oil.
Many factors are taken into consideration in tank design not only for the air oil security,
but also the physical strength to remain intact against rough handling and transportation.
Thickness of steel material is in accordance with domestic or international standards.
The windings of high-conductivity copper and transposed winding conductors are employed
where appopriate, and designed to reduce to a minimum the out-of balance electro-magnetic
forces in the transformer at all voltage ratios.
The windings and connections are adequately braced to withstand mechanical shocks
and electro-magnetic impulsive forces which may occur during handling,
transportation and service.
The insulation of windings and connections are designed to withstand the abnormal voltage
stresses occuring in power systems. Also, they are not liable to soften, ooze out, shrink or
collapse during service.
Special grade, heat-treated, grain-oriented silicon steels are used to minimize hysterisis. |
